Teresa M. Von Rueden, Grand Forks, ND died peacefully December 9, 2009 at 104 years of age at Valley Eldercare Center in Grand Forks.

Teresa Margaret Ackerman Von Rueden was born April 8, 1905 in Reynolds, ND the daughter of Julius and Anna Marie (Schreiner) Ackerman. She was the third oldest of 10 children, 6 girls and 4 boys. She completed 8th grade, which was quite an accomplishment in her day and worked in her youth on the farm with her siblings. Very involved in church, she sang in the choir as a youth in Reynolds where she met John Von Rueden, her future husband. She married John L. Von Rueden of Hatton, ND on April 22, 1924. Teresa and John raised their three children in the Grand Forks Riverside Park neighborhood. They were devoted Catholics and life-long active members of St. Michaels Catholic Church, where Teresa was a member of the Altar Society, the Bridge Builders club and loved singing in the Choir. Teresa and John were very active members of the Grand Forks Elks Club, rarely missing a Saturday night dance with their many close friends. She found great joy in music and played piano by ear, sang at many local functions and encouraged her children and grandchildren's involvement and love of music and entertainment. While John ran his Barber Shop downtown, Teresa worked as a well-known area seamstress for many years getting to know many families in the Grand Forks area through her work. She also worked for Bray's and Norby's department stores doing alterations. She did all of this without driving as in her life, Teresa never desired to drive a car or get her driver's license.

Teresa was devoted to her children and grandchildren and she loved to be around young people. She spent many summers working at Riverside Pool where her sons were lifeguards because of her belief that "being around young people will keep me young." Her belief in this and her healthy approach to exercise and living stayed with her until the end. She will always be remembered as a caring, loving, fun, energetic, faith-driven, fashionable, beautiful woman. Her compassion, smile, always stylish presence and quick humor will be remembered by all who knew her. Her religious beliefs lead her to a quality of life she cherished and when it was time for her to go home, she looked forward to the journey.
